The Intricate Dance of Serotonin Pathways

Serotonin (5-HT) is a crucial monoamine neurotransmitter originating in the raphe nuclei of the brainstem, with diffuse projections reaching numerous structures throughout the central nervous system. This widespread distribution allows serotonin to influence a vast array of bodily functions, including mood, social behavior, appetite, digestion, sleep, memory, and motor skills. Given its broad impact, an imbalance in serotonin levels has been associated with various challenges to mental and emotional wellbeing.

Recent research has illuminated a greater complexity within the serotonin system than previously understood. A pivotal study from Stanford University, led by biologist Liqun Luo, revealed that our brain's serotonin system is actually composed of multiple parallel subsystems. These subsystems can function differently, and at times, in opposing ways, which helps to clarify past divergent research findings. This insight suggests that by targeting specific pathways, we may be able to address particular aspects of wellbeing without unintended side effects.

The influence of music on these serotonin pathways has garnered significant scientific attention. Auditory stimulation, especially through melodic music, has been shown to increase activity in key brain regions. Specifically, it may increase serotonin (5-HT) activity in the caudate-putamen (CPu), also known as the dorsal striatum. This region is critically linked to pleasure, reward mechanisms, and motor control, suggesting a direct neurological response to musical input.

Furthermore, studies utilizing classical music, such as Mozart’s sonata, have been associated with an increase in serotonin metabolites concentration in the CPu of adult rats (Moraes et al., 2018). This suggests that certain musical exposures may actively modulate serotonin levels within the brain. The quality of music also appears to be a factor; researchers measured an increase in serotonin platelets in response to pleasant music, while unpleasant music correlated with a decrease, indicating a modulated release of serotonin based on the music's emotional valence (Evers and Suhr, 2000).

The Power of Harmonic Frequencies on Neural Pathways

Our brains are comprised of a phenomenal mass of neural pathways, connecting each neuron, which profoundly affect our bodies. The more consistently we use each neural pathway, the more entrenched and efficient it becomes in processing information. Similarly, the more we listen to certain music, the emotional effect it has on us becomes deeply ingrained within these neural pathways. Music is indeed one of the most powerful elicitors of subjective emotion.

Harmonic frequencies, which are integer multiples of a fundamental frequency, create a rich, resonant sound quality that our brains process distinctly. Research into ultrasonic vocalizations (USVs) in animals, for example, has shown a link between serotonin manipulation and harmonic vocalizations. One study found that increased serotonin levels cause male mice to be more responsive to female signals, notably affecting harmonic vocalizations (Hood and Hurley, 2024). This suggests a focused effect of serotonin on the generation and perception of harmonic sounds.

The impact of harmonic frequencies extends beyond mere emotional response; it touches upon the very structure and function of the brain. A substantial body of clinical data has been amassed showing the positive effects of music on structural and emotional processors in various brain disorders. This includes developmental and acquired brain disorders such as autism, strokes, and even neurodegenerative diseases (Clark, Downey & Warren, 2014). Such findings underscore music's potential as a complementary tool in supporting brain health and function.

The specific dynamics of serotonin release are also influenced by frequency. Studies have shown that high-frequency stimulation (e.g., 10-20 Hz) can induce extrasynaptic release of 5-HT, affecting receptors and neurons not typically targeted by purely synaptic release induced by low-frequency stimulation (e.g., 1 Hz) (Trueta and De-Miguel, 2012). This suggests that different sound frequencies, by modulating serotonin release dynamics, may elicit distinct effects on brain networks. Ultraslow serotonin oscillations in the hippocampus have also been shown to influence brain activity patterns, indicating a complex interplay between frequency and serotonin function.

Moreover, the interaction between specific serotonin receptors and music has been investigated. Lysergic acid diethylamide (LSD), a psychedelic drug acting as a 5-HT2A receptor agonist, has been shown to increase cortical excitation via increased 5-HT2A receptor signaling. When participants listened to music under the influence of LSD, brain activity assessed by BOLD signals revealed that 5-HT2A receptor signaling is implicated in neural responses to music in regions related to higher-level musical processing (F. S. Barrett et al., 2018). This further supports the idea that serotonin pathways are crucial for music-induced emotionality, meaningfulness, and a sense of connectedness.

How It Works in Practice

Connecting the scientific insights to tangible, felt experiences is at the core of sound wellness. When you immerse yourself in a sound bath, the carefully curated harmonic frequencies act as gentle invitations for your brain and body to shift into a state of deep relaxation. This isn't just about passive listening; it's an active engagement with resonant vibrations that may subtly influence your internal chemistry.

Imagine lying comfortably as the studio fills with the rich, complex overtones of Himalayan singing bowls and the deep, undulating waves of gongs. These instruments produce a spectrum of harmonic frequencies that are designed to be both auditory and somatic; you hear the sound, and you feel the vibration resonating through your body. This sensory immersion creates a unique environment for the brain. The brain's activity patterns, specifically brainwaves, have been observed to entrain with external rhythmic stimuli. In a sound wellness session, the aim is often to guide brainwave states towards alpha (relaxed awareness) and theta (deep relaxation, meditative) frequencies.

As your brain activity potentially shifts, preliminary studies suggest this experience may support the modulation of neurochemical release, including serotonin. The calming effect often reported during and after a session is not merely psychological; it may be linked to these physiological changes. This complementary approach to wellbeing focuses on creating conditions conducive to the body's natural restorative processes.

Clients often describe a profound sense of tranquility, a release of tension, and an enhanced feeling of mental clarity after a session. The gentle, consistent presence of harmonic frequencies may help to quiet the sympathetic nervous system (our "fight or flight" response) and activate the parasympathetic nervous system (our "rest and digest" state). This shift, in turn, has been associated with a more balanced emotional state, reduced perceived stress, and an improved sense of overall wellbeing.

Your Next Steps

Embracing the potential of harmonic frequencies for your wellbeing doesn't always require a formal session right away, though it is a powerful catalyst. You can begin integrating sound into your daily self-care practice with simple, actionable steps. Consistency is key, as regular engagement with calming sounds may help entrench those positive neural pathways we discussed.

Here are a few practical pieces of advice you can implement today:

  • Mindful Listening: Dedicate time each day to listen to calming, harmonic music without distraction. Choose instrumental pieces, classical music, or nature sounds that feature rich overtones. Focus on the nuances of the sound, letting it wash over you and noting any shifts in your internal state.
  • Explore Binaural Beats or Isochronic Tones: These audio technologies use specific frequencies to encourage brainwave entrainment, potentially guiding your brain into alpha or theta states associated with relaxation. Many apps and online resources offer guided sessions for different intentions.
  • Simple Vocal Toning: Humming or gently chanting can create resonant vibrations within your own body. This simple act of self-produced sound can be surprisingly soothing and is an accessible way to engage with internal harmonics.
  • Create a Serene Sound Environment: Consider incorporating chimes, water features, or soft, ambient music into your living or working space. A consistent backdrop of pleasant sounds may contribute to a more relaxed and balanced atmosphere throughout your day.
